[ELF] - Print LMA in a -Map file.

Currently, LLD prints VA, but not LMA in a map file.
It seems can be useful to print both to reveal layout
details and patch implements it.

# REQUIRES: x86
# RUN: llvm-mc -filetype=obj -triple=x86_64-pc-linux %p/Inputs/map-file2.s -o %t.o
# RUN: ld.lld -o %t %t.o -Map=%t.map --script %s
# RUN: FileCheck -strict-whitespace %s < %t.map
SECTIONS {
. = 0x1000;
.aaa : { *(.aaa.*) }
.bbb : AT(0x2000) { *(.bbb.*) }
.ccc : AT(0x3000) { *(.ccc.*) }
.ddd : {
BYTE(0x11)
. += 0x100;
*(.ddd.*)
}
.text : { *(.text.*) }
}
